Terri Ross to speak at The Aesthetic Meeting 2021 APX by Terri Ross
Terri Ross, Founder of the aesthetic practice accelerator platform 'APX', to present "Increase Revenue Through Solutions Based Software and Data" educational session alongside Dr. Barry Fernando

BEVERLY HILLS, Calif. - PennZone -- Terri Ross, renowned aesthetic practice consultant and Founder of APX, will be a featured faculty speaker at The Aesthetic Meeting 2021 on Saturday, May 1st in Miami Beach, Florida. Ross will be joined by Dr. Barry Fernando, a plastic surgeon and the CEO of Ronan Solutions™/Anzu Medical, as they present a 2 hour comprehensive workshop "Increase Revenue Through Solutions Based Software and Data" at 2:30pm EST.

The Aesthetic Meeting 2021 will be held at the Miami Beach Convention Center from May 1-3. Society members who attend this free workshop will learn how to:
  • Address the common roadblocks in managing aesthetic practices
  • Discuss changing the mindset as to why data matters
  • Identify how to use solution-based software to overcome these roadblocks
  • Recognize the top KPIs to measure growth in your practice
  • Evaluate how industry benchmarking data and financial calculators will allow you to be more efficient and profitable

APX by Terri Ross, a business intelligence cloud platform that accelerates the growth of aesthetic practices through on-demand employee training modules, financial algorithms, KPI calculators, and integrative marketing dashboards, recently announced the formation of a strategic partnership with Ronan Solutions™to provide exclusive benchmarking data to the medical aesthetics industry.

ABOUT 'APX BY TERRI ROSS'


Founded in 2021 by renowned practice consultant Terri Ross in response to the COVID-19 pandemic's impact on the aesthetic industry, 'APX by Terri Ross' is a business intelligence platform that accelerates the growth and scalability of aesthetic practices. A practice growth software that can increase revenue by up to 2,800% for some clients, APX optimizes employee performance through interactive on-demand training courses; increases practice profitability and growth through financial algorithms and dashboards; and ensures retention and adaptability through LIVE coaching sessions and community interaction with the APX team.
